  • Publication number: 20150276113
    Abstract: A pipe-in-pipe system, including: an outer pipe; an inner pipe disposed within the outer pipe; a mid line assembly configured to connect the outer pipe and the inner pipe to a current source; and an annulus region between an outer surface of the inner pipe and an inner surface of the outer pipe, wherein the annulus region includes a conductive or semiconductive electrical path configured to carry current between the inner pipe and the outer pipe.

  • Publication number: 20140201243
    Abstract: A method for generating a model of a physical entity, in particular the earth, using one or more hierarchically organized multi-resolutional data trees T, each data tree comprising a plurality of nodes Nk, each node having a grid with a fixed number of points, wherein each node can store an arbitrary number of data items, each holding scalar field values for each point in the grid, the method comprising the steps of creating a geometry using one or more data trees; and creating an associated overlay using one or more data trees, wherein at least one of the geometry and overlay comprises a formula to be applied to data within one or more data trees. This enables manipulation of the data within the data trees during rendering and increases the adaptability of the model without an increase in the required memory space. In preferred embodiments the nodes of the data trees comprise time dependent geo-references to allow the data trees to be time rotated.
